Green Mushroom Farm Supplies

Cultivating fungi sustainably requires careful check here consideration of the ingredients used. Traditional cultivation methods often rely on sphagnum peat, a material that's being extracted from vulnerable ecosystems. Thankfully, green replacements are rapidly accessible. These include coco coir, shavings, hemp hurd, and crop leftovers like rice hulls. Switching to these sustainable materials not only decreases your ecological footprint but can also enhance the vitality of your yields. Using these eco-conscious alternatives is a essential step towards a sustainable mushroom venture.

Finding the Best Substrate for Your Funghi Operation

Properly raising flavorful mushrooms copyrights heavily on choosing the right substrate. This nutrient-rich medium provides the vital ingredients your mycelium demand to thrive. Common substrates include a range of options, including straw, sawdust, coconut coir, and composted manure. The preferred choice varies on the particular fungi you intend to cultivate. As an example, oyster mushrooms typically do remarkably well on straw while brown cap toadstools favor a timber substrate such as chips. Finally, researching the precise substrate preferences of your chosen toadstool variety is absolutely necessary for a bountiful yield.
